About the Extender Series VGA Line Drivers

The Extron Extender Series are one-input VGA–UXGA line
drivers with audio. There are nine models in the series:
Extender AAP, Extender AAP EX, Extender WM, Extender D,
Extender WM AAP, Extender WM AUS, Extender MK,
Extender AKM UK AAP, and Extender AKM MAAP. They
boost the video signal between a laptop or desktop computer
and a monitor or projector. Each has a 300 MHz (-3 dB) video
bandwidth.
Each line driver accepts one computer-video input and one
stereo audio input. Each Extender also features one buffered
VGA-type RGB output and one stereo audio output. With
an optional Mac/VGA adapter, the Extender can also buffer
Macintosh signals.

Differences between the models

All Extender models are functionally identical but they have
mounting options.
For details about mounting the Extender AAP, Extender WM,
Extender D, Extender WM AAP, Extender WM AUS, and the
Extender MK, see "Preparing the Site and Installing the Wall
Box" in chapter 2.
For Extender AAP EX mounting instructions, refer to the user's
manual or installation manual for the appropriate model of HSA
Hideaway Surface Access enclosure.
For Extender AKM UK AAP mounting instructions, refer to
the AKM UK Series Installation Guide (part number 68-904-01),
available at http://www.extron.com.
For Extender AKM MAAP mounting instructions, refer to
the Extender AKM MAAP Installation Guide (part number
68-1031-01), available at http://www.extron.com.
